If your landscape company does work in the City and County of Denver, you might be interested in the new green roof initiative and its implementation. There is a meeting tomorrow, March 21, of the Green Roofs Review Task Force, and the public is invited to observe. To follow is an email about the task force that was sent by the Denver Department of Public Health and Environment:

Denver's Department of Public Health & Environment has convened the Green Roofs Review Task Force to examine how best to achieve the benefits of the green roofs ordinance, while possibly expanding compliance options for new and existing buildings. The group's fifth of eight meetings is scheduled for Wednesday, March 21, 9:00 a.m. -12:00 p.m. at 200 W 14th Ave, 2nd Floor, Grand Mesa Room. Meetings are open to the public to observe. H-2B update

Here is the latest update from the lobbyist for the H-2B Workforce Coalition:

Congress is close to wrapping up its negotiations over a spending bill for the remainder of fiscal 2018. We believe H-2B cap relief will be included in that package thanks to everyone’s continued advocacy and outreach. We expect that the bill will include substantial relief for two years, as well as the first permanent cap relief in decades. While the language being negotiated will not satisfy 100% of the demand for H-2B visas, it is a significant step forward. The final negotiations over the spending bill should be wrapped up on Monday.

While calls to your lawmakers in your home state urging cap relief are helpful, we strongly recommend that you do not reference any specific language, which is counterproductive in the middle of delicate negotiations. Also, please do not call any Senators or Representatives beyond your elected officials. Congressional staff see non-constituent phone calls and a waste of time and not helpful.

We will keep you updated on the status of cap relief in the final spending bill and let you know the details as soon as a bill is released.

Steve SteeleOver the past several years there has been a significant change in the psyche of America. Nearly all of us that live in this great nation are here because someone in our family tree emigrated here in the past from another country to make a better life for themselves and their loved ones. However, today’s xenophobic assumptions that anyone who looks or sounds different from us is here illegally and stealing a job that a real “‘merican” could do is not only incorrect in most cases, but also has negative repercussions for all Americans. That is why I feel compelled to tell anyone that will listen why it is critical that America’s labor pool be augmented through non-immigrant, temporary worker visa programs, like H-2B, that provide workers willing to perform jobs that most Americans do not want – cleaning hotel rooms, mowing grass, and a myriad of other labor-intensive and often seasonal jobs – while at the same time raising pay and advancement opportunities for their American counterparts.
